Artifactory

Artifactory is a universal artifact repository manager that stores, organizes, and manages binary artifacts throughout the software development lifecycle. It supports various package formats such as Maven, npm, and NuGet, allowing for seamless integration with build tools and CI/CD pipelines. Artifactory enhances collaboration and efficiency in development by centralizing artifact storage and providing robust version control and access management capabilities.

0 Enrolled No ratings yet Intermediate

The Artifactory course provides a comprehensive overview of Artifactory, a universal artifact repository manager that enables organizations to store, manage, and share software artifacts. Participants will learn about Artifactory’s architecture, its benefits, and how it compares to other artifact repositories. The course covers the installation of Artifactory on various operating systems, along with configuration settings and verification of the installation.

Learners will explore how to create and manage repositories for different package types, including Maven, npm, and NuGet. They will understand how to deploy and retrieve artifacts using Artifactory and integrate it with popular build tools like Maven, Gradle, and npm. The course will also delve into security configurations, user and role management, and authentication processes.

In addition, participants will learn how to integrate Artifactory with CI/CD tools such as Jenkins and GitLab CI, as well as with artifact scanners like SonarQube. Advanced topics such as Artifactory clustering, administration, and performance optimization will also be covered. Practical examples and case studies will provide hands-on experience in managing artifacts and integrating Artifactory into the development workflow.

What You’ll Learn

  • Artifactory Fundamentals: Understand what Artifactory is, its architecture, and its advantages over other artifact repositories.
  • Installation and Configuration: Learn how to install Artifactory on different operating systems, configure settings, and verify the installation.
  • Creating and Managing Repositories: Explore how to create new repositories for various package types and manage their settings and content.
  • Using Artifactory: Understand how to deploy artifacts to Artifactory, retrieve them, and use Artifactory with build tools like Maven, Gradle, and npm.
  • Artifactory Security: Learn about security configurations, managing users and roles, and authenticating users within Artifactory.
  • Integration with CI/CD Tools: Discover how to integrate Artifactory with CI/CD tools like Jenkins and GitLab CI, and with artifact scanners like SonarQube.
  • Advanced Artifactory Features: Explore advanced topics including clustering, administration, and performance optimization for Artifactory.
  • Practical Applications: Gain hands-on experience in managing Maven artifacts, deploying npm packages, and integrating Artifactory into your development workflow for effective artifact management.
Show More
Free
Free acess this course

Anurag

0.0Instructor Rating
38
Students
39
Courses
0
Reviews
View Details

Want to receive push notifications for all major on-site activities?

Enroll For Coding Challange

Please enable JavaScript in your browser to complete this form.

Join For Free

Please enable JavaScript in your browser to complete this form.